It is called Ubuntu because:

1. Ubuntu is a South African word meaning "towards humanity." It is basically the concept of being part of a community that helps each other.

2. Ubuntu (the distro) lives up to this by helping people to get a free copy, and offering caring and helpful support to the people on it's forums.

3. The creator, Mark Shuttleworth, is from South Africa.
